Establishment and Preliminary Studies on the Skin Tissue Hair Follicles Proteins of 2-DE Map Building in Fine-wool Sheep

Abstract: In use of hair follicles in skin tissue of fine-wool sheep with different fiber diameters as experimental material, and different extraction methods, IPG strips with different pH and different sample volume as experimental methods, this paper was aimed to explore two-dimensional electrophoresis system applied to skin tissue of the fine-wool sheep and establish 2-DE gel map of skin tissue in fine-wool sheep.Gel maps using ImageMaster 2D Platinum software automatically detected protein points to compare different protein fiber diameter of fine-wool sheep differences.The results showed that the TCA/acetone extraction method was most suited to fine-wool sheep hair follicle tissue extraction of total protein.Choose to 18 cm, pH 4 to 7 linear IPG strip, we got better quality two-dimensional gel electrophoresis, got 35 protein variations among the different cantons for the follow-up work fine-wool sheep with high quality of the study of proteomics.

Key words: fine-wool sheep; two-dimensional electrophoresis; hair follicles; proteomics
